How many milligrams of magnesium reacts with excess HCl to produce 31.2 mL of hydrogen gas at 754 Torr and 25.0℃.
Ivanshal [37]

Answer:

There will react 30.9 milligrams of magnesium

Explanation:

Step 1: Data given

Volume of hydrogen = 31.2 mL

Pressure = 754 torr = 754/760 = 0.992 atm

Temperature = 25.0 °C = 298 Kelvin

Step 2: The balanced equation

Mg + 2HCl → MgCl2 + H2

Step 3: Calculate moles of H2

p*V = n*R*T

⇒ with p = the pressure of H2 = 0.992 atm

⇒with V = the volume of H2 = 31.2 mL = 0.0312 L

⇒ with n = the moles of H2 = TO BE DETERMINED

⇒ with R = the gas constant = 0.08206 L*atm/K*mol

⇒ with T= the temperature = 25.0 °C = 298 Kelvin

n = (p*V)/(R*T)

n = (0.992*0.0312)/(0.08206*298)

n = 0.00127 moles

Step 4: Calculate moles of Mg

For 1 mol of Mg we need 2 moles of HCl to produce 1 mol of MgCl2 and 1 mol of H2

For 0.00127 moles of H2 we need 0.00127 moles of Mg

Step 5: Calculate mass of Mg

Mass of Mg = moles of Mg * molar mass of Mg

Mass of Mg = 0.00127 moles * 24.3 g/mol

Mass of Mg = 0.0309 grams = 30.9 mg of Mg

There will react 30.9 milligrams of magnesium

A gaseous substance turns directly into a solid. Which term describes this change?
UkoKoshka [18]

Answer:

deposition

Explanation:

Sublmation- solid transforming into a gas, skipping the liquid stage.

eveporation- a liquid transformimg into a gas

melting- a solid transforming into a liquid

deposition- the opposite of sublimation (your anwser)
